Key Maintenance Strategies for Floating Head Heat Exchangers


Regular Inspections and Cleaning: Routine inspections and cleaning procedures are essential to prevent fouling, corrosion, and wear, which can impede heat transfer efficiency and reduce the lifespan of FHEs. Precision Equipment recommends inspecting FHEs for any signs of damage or deterioration, and regularly cleaning them with appropriate cleaning agents and methods.

Monitoring and Managing Thermal Expansion: Thermal expansion is a natural phenomenon that can occur in FHEs, resulting in excessive stress on components if not properly managed. Precision Equipment recommends diligently monitoring thermal expansion and implementing appropriate measures, such as using expansion joints and flexible connections, to minimize stress and ensure the longevity of FHEs.

Corrosion Prevention Measures: Corrosion is a major threat to the lifespan of FHEs, especially in harsh operating environments. Precision Equipment employs advanced corrosion-resistant materials in their FHEs, and recommends using corrosion inhibitors and protective coatings to further safeguard against corrosive elements.

Temperature and Pressure Control: Operating FHEs within the recommended temperature and pressure ranges is crucial to minimize thermal stress and enhance their reliability and lifespan. Precision Equipment recommends strictly adhering to the manufacturer's guidelines to ensure optimal operating conditions for FHEs.

Timely Replacement of Components: Over time, FHE components naturally undergo wear and tear, which can lead to unexpected failures and disrupt operations. Precision Equipment recommends proactively identifying and replacing worn-out parts, such as gaskets and seals, to prevent unexpected downtime and ensure continuous, trouble-free operation of FHEs.
